if you e-filed and it was accepted or mailed it in, Turbotax receives no updates. the IRS is far behind in processing refunds. millions are waiting for them. all you can really do is wait and check the IRS refund website.
There is no such thing as a direct deposit fee. E-filing is free, and so is having your refund direct deposited. If you choose the option to pay your TurboTax fees by having the fees deducted from your federal refund, you pay a refund processing fee of $39.99 ($44.99 in CA) to have a third party bank receive the refund, extract the fees, and send you the rest.
Check the status of your refund at IRS Where's My Refund or call the IRS. If you did use the refund processing service, then the TurboTax help desk can look up your return and give you a status.
